Houston Rockets

The Houston Rockets are one of a handful of teams in the NBA that is attempting to build a roster littered with young players.

Kevin Porter Jr. and Jalen Green are expected to be the backcourt duo of the future while Christian Wood, Jae’Sean Tate, and Kenyon Martin Jr. handle the frontcourt. As of now, Eric Gordon and Danuel House remain members of the Rockets.

However, with Houston wanting a young roster, Cam Reddish would be a nice fit on the Houston Rockets. Maybe the Hawks would take either Gordon or House — plus more — for Reddish in a trade this season.

On a team like the Houston Rockets, Reddish would actually be a player with solid experience, especially having just made a deep playoff run with Atlanta last season.

Reddish could immediately make an impact on a Houston team that doesn’t have any pressure of advancing to the postseason yet.
